Practical Steps for Replacing Chimney Pots

What Does a Chimney Pot Do?A chimney top channels smoke safely away from your home, aiding effective draught and safe ventilation. If it becomes ineffective, it can lead to draught problems, damp, or even weather-related damage. Why Many Still Prefer Traditional Chimney Pots

Why These Designs Continue to Be Used These chimney pots have been used for decades, and many property owners still choose them . Their simple, upright form suits older houses and fits nicely with properties built in brick or stone . The structure encourages good airflow, which helps to reduce downdraught.
